Hybrid SLI and 3-way SLI Ready with K9N2 Diamond
The Best Performance Gaming Solution on AM2+ Platform
 
 
City of Industry , CA – May 6, 2008 - MSI, a leading force in the computing industry is proud to announce the new line of motherboards for the AM2+ Platform – The K9N2 Series. Powered by the NForce chipset from NVIDIA ® , the K9N2 Series supports multi-GPU SLI that is the first choice for gaming systems and power users. While this performance-enhancing technology consumes high power levels and creates noise that is cause for concern, MSI is proud to usher in the Green Computing era with Hybrid SLI technology – balancing extreme power while doing our part to conserve the environment. K9N2 Series motherboards will offer spectacular performance when demanding applications are in use, while throttling down power consumption and fan noise when it isn't required. The K9N2 Diamond utilizes nForce780a chipset together with top performance specifications and supports 3-way SLI technology for the ultimate gaming experience. The K9N2 SLI Platinum utilizes nForce750a chipset, making this motherboard the cost-effective choice with NVIDIA ® SLI technology. “K9N2 series motherboards are the best gaming choice on AMD platform,” says Vincent Lai, MSI worldwide marketing director.

 
Highly Efficient Circu-Pipe and 5 phase PWM

The use of selected high-grade components is the common characteristic of the K9N2 series motherboards. Although the two motherboards have different market segments, they both come with MSI's exclusive Circu-Pipe design. Circu-Pipe can effectively reduce the high temperature from the chipset and MOSFET by over 10%. This design improves the system stability and product life for maximum lifespan. The processor power supply of K9N2 series motherboards has a five phase PWM design. Through MSI's power design, it allows the power supply to become more stable, but also reduces the heat produced, especially during huge over-clocking ranges.
 
Selected high-quality solid cap and Hi-c CAP!

The MSI K9N2 series utilize high-quality solid capacitors that are made in Japan . These capacitors with low impedance and high ripple current provide better filtering effects for the board. To further highlight MSI K9N2 series products, the PWM capacitors on these motherboards are based on Hi-c CAP (Highly-conductive polymerized Capacitor), a high grade component. The biggest benefit of HI-C CAP is that in all kinds of operating frequencies, this product can maintain low impedance characteristics, making it the suitable choice for motherboards with high-frequency switching power supply.
 
Hybrid SLI and 3-way SLI ready!

MSI K9N2 series motherboards are Hybrid SLI ready. Hybrid SLI is based on NVIDIA's SLI technology which delivers multi-GPU benefits when an NVIDIA motherboard GPU (mGPU) is combined with an NVIDIA-based discrete GPU. Hybrid SLI increases graphics performance with GeForce Boost and provides intelligent power management with HybridPower. Plug any NVIDIA HybridPower-enabled GPU into any NVIDIA Hybrid SLI-enabled motherboard for the ultimate control. HybridPower unleashes graphics performance when needed and switches to quiet, low-power operation for computing tasks that doesn't require high 3D performance like browsing the Web or word processing.

The K9N2 Diamond and K9N2 SLI Platinum are based on different chipsets; the K9N2 Diamond is 3-way SLI technology ready, which can combine 3 VGA cards to process tasks, which brings higher 3D gaming resolutions with more detail DX10 effects, and also enhances the 3D frame rate to a higher level for a more smooth gaming experience. The K9N2 SLI Platinum only supports SLI technology, but through PCI-E bandwidth upgrade to Gen2, it can raise performance in heavy loading scenarios. These two motherboards have different specifications – the K9N2 Diamond has an extreme performance design, while the KN92 Platinum is the Cost/Performance value product.
 
 
K9N2 Diamond Product Specifications
  • NVIDIA nForce 780a SLI chipset based
  • Support AMD Socket AM2+/AM2 Phenom, Athlon and Sempron processors
  • 3 PCI-E x16 slots (PCI Express Bus SPEC V2.0 compliant)
  • Supports x16 speed SLI & 3-way SLI Technology ( x16, x8, x8 )
  • 4 dual channel DIMMs DDRII 533/667/800/1066 up to 8GB
  • 2 ports 10/100/1000 LAN
  • X-Fi Xtreme Audio card, support 24-bit / 96KHz audio quality, 100dB SNR clarity, u p to 7.1 Ch., EAX 4.0 Surround Sound
  • Supports 6 SATAII, supports RAID 0/1/0+1/5
  • Supports 2 e-SATA ports
  • 1 PCI-E x1, 2 PCI slots
  • 10x USB 2.0, 2x IEEE1394
  • Circu-Pipe Heatsink design
  • Dual CoreCell technology with D.O.T. Express
 
 
K9N2 SLI Platinum Product Specifications
  • NVIDIA nForce 750a SLI chipset based
  • Support AMD Socket AM2+/AM2 Phenom, Athlon and Sempron processors
  • 2 PCI-E x16 slots (PCI Express Bus SPEC V2.0 compliant)
  • Supports x8 speed SLI Technology
  • 4 dual channel DIMMs DDRII 533/667/800/1066/1200 up to 8GB
  • 1 port 10/100/1000 LAN
  • 7.1 channel surround Audio
  • Supports 6 SATAII, supports RAID 0/1/0+1/5
  • Supports 2 e-SATA ports
  • 2 PCI-E x16, 1 PCI-E x1, 2 PCI slots
  • 10x USB 2.0, 2x IEEE1394
  • Circu-Pipe Heatsink design
  • Dual CoreCell technology with D.O.T. Express
